Run the following command to check the current WinRM listener configuration:
powershell
winrm get winrm/config/listener
Look for the listener that uses the HTTP transport (usually on port 5985) and note its Transport and Port values.
Remove the existing listener by running the following command:
powershell
winrm delete winrm/config/listener?Address=*+Transport=HTTP
Create a new listener with HTTPS transport by running the following command:
powershell
winrm create winrm/config/listener?Address=*+Transport=HTTPS '@{Hostname="<hostname>"; CertificateThumbprint="<thumbprint>"; Port="<port>"}'
Replace <hostname> with the hostname or IP address of the server, <thumbprint> with the thumbprint of a valid SSL certificate installed on the server, and <port> with the desired port number (typically 5986 for HTTPS).
Run the following command to check the updated WinRM listener configuration:
powershell
winrm get winrm/config/listener
Once the listener is configured for HTTPS, update your Ansible playbook with the new transport and port values:
yaml
ansible_connection: winrm
ansible_winrm_transport: https
ansible_winrm_port: <port>
Replace <port> with the same port number used during the listener creation (e.g., 5986).
Save the updated playbook and run it using the ansible-playbook command. Ansible will now establish a secure HTTPS connection to the Windows Server.
